When I was talking to someone in the family, they brought up the idea of possibly acquiring a UK Ancestry visa instead of the Tier 5 YMS visa to give me a couple of extra years in the UK.

I looked into it because my grandmother was born in the UK....however, she is not my biological grandmother (my biological grandmother died before I was born and was German). Nowhereon the UKBA website can I find information regarding this circumstance.....I did find an adoption clause but that doesn't quite fit my circumstance. Does anyone know if it is possible to acquire an Ancestry Visa with a grandmother who is not biologically related?

If your grand-mother is not related by you either by birth or by adoption, you won't be able to claim UK Ancestry.
